Press F8 during boot to access the startup menu and select safe mode if you are having probs booting up. Click Start-Run and type "regedit" in the box (no quotes) and hit enter. The w98 registry editor will start.
Click the plus (+) next to H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E. This will expand the topic.
Click the plus next to softwre under this item.
Click the plus next to Microsoft.
Scroll down under Microsoft until you find Windows.
Click the plus next to Windows.
Click on the title "Current Version", usually the first entry under Windows. Click on the title not the plus.
In the right side window, scroll down to Product Key.
Under data on the right side is your original key. Write this down and double check it. Then close the registry editor by clicking X on the title bar at the top.
As log as you don't type anything in the data fields, you won't change the registry.
The Product key is the install key for your disk.
